What did the astronauts do with the lunar rovers when they were done with them?

The rover was folded and stored in the bay with the underside of the chassis facing out. One astronaut would climb the egress ladder on the LM and release the rover, which would then be slowly tilted out by the second astronaut on the ground through the use of reels and tapes.

What do we call the side of the moon we Cannot see?

There is a ‘dark side’ of the moon, but you are probably using the term incorrectly all of the time. People often say “dark side” of the moon when referring to the lunar face we can’t see from Earth. This common use of the phrase is wrong — the term scientists use is the “far side.”

Why does the far side of the moon look different?

The near side of the moon (left) looks very different from the far side. The American Geophysical Union announced a new study on May 20, 2019, based on new evidence about the moon’s crust, suggesting the differences were caused by a wayward dwarf planet colliding with the moon in the early history of the solar system.

Can we see the backside of the Moon?

As the Earth is much larger than the Moon, the Moon’s rotation is slowed down until it reaches a balance point. As this NASA animation shows (right), this means that the same portion of the Moon always faces towards the Earth, and we can never see the far side.

How did astronauts navigate on the moon?

Apollo astronauts used three navigation systems to determine the proper flight paths to the Moon and back to Earth. An optical navigation system consisted of a scanning telescope and a sextant. With these instruments the astronauts could take star sights and plot the position of their spacecraft.
